Why does my Sierra Ridge Estates lawn struggle despite regular watering and fertilizing?

Sierra Ridge Estates lots, built around 2016, have soil with approximately 10 years of maturation. The alkaline clay loam (pH 7.8-8.2) common here compacts easily, reducing oxygen availability to roots. This soil type requires annual core aeration to improve permeability and organic amendments like compost to lower pH. Without these interventions, water and nutrients cannot effectively reach the root zone of Tall Fescue turf.

Why choose sandstone over wood for patios in fire-prone areas?

Permeable Colorado Buff Sandstone provides superior fire resistance compared to combustible wood materials, supporting Moderate WUI Zone 2 defensible space requirements. This natural stone maintains structural integrity at temperatures exceeding 1,200°F and doesn't require chemical treatments that degrade over time. Its 50+ year lifespan and non-combustible nature make it ideal for Sierra Ridge's fire-wise landscape planning.
